На главную Наши проекты:
Журнал   ·   Discuz!ML   ·   Wiki   ·   DRKB   ·   Помощь проекту
ПРАВИЛА FAQ Помощь Участники Календарь Избранное RSS
msm.ru
  
> Deploy from HG
    Есть задача:
    Необходимо обновить код на сервере в соответствии с последними изменениями в Mercurial (HG) репозитории.

    Текущая специфика:
    На сервере не установлен HG.
    Установлен только Git (& git-svn).

    Возможные методы решения задачи:
    1) Установить на сервере Mercurial и обновляться штатными средствами
    2) Установить на сервере Mercurial + Hg-Git и экспортировать из HG в Git
    3) Установить только HG-плагин для Гит, и импортировать из HG в Git.
    4) Найти простой Php/Perl/Python скрипт, который будет обновлять код прямо из HG-репозитория (без Git, без Hg).
    (Кстати, ГДЕ бы такой найти? Для SVN я такой написал на PHP, а для Git/HG пока не нашел)

    Какой вариант лучше выбрать?

    Вот один из вариантов решения (а именно #3), с кратким упоминанием других существующих инструментов:
    http://felipec.wordpress.com/2012/11/13/git-remote-hg-bzr-2/

    P.S.
    Никак не удаётся уговорить неграма посмотреть на сие чудо :)
    Сообщение отредактировано: vot -
      3-й вариант возможен и через гитхаб
        Цитата Dark Side @
        3-й вариант возможен и через гитхаб

        Репы хранятся на гуглокоде и битбакете, в обоих случаях под Hg.
        Так что гитхаб вроде как лишний в данном случае...
        0 пользователей читают эту тему (0 гостей и 0 скрытых пользователей)
        0 пользователей:


        Рейтинг@Mail.ru
        [ Script execution time: 0,0453 ]   [ 16 queries used ]   [ Generated: 19.04.24, 04:31 GMT ]